‘Traumschiff’ New Year’s Episode Draws Backlash Over Suicide Plot, Yet Leads Young Viewers

Mental-health advocates warn the portrayal may encourage imitation without adequate safeguards.

Overview

  • The ZDF episode Das TraumschiffMadikwe aired on January 1 and included a storyline in which passengers discuss jumping overboard, triggering immediate criticism from viewers and national outlets.
  • Commentators faulted the near-comic tone and said the broadcast lacked a pre-show trigger warning, noting only a brief helpline notice appeared after the closing sequence.
  • Germany’s Stiftung Deutsche Depressionshilfe und Suizidprävention highlighted the Werther-effect risk from prominent, emotional depictions of suicide without careful framing and support information.
  • A separate subplot about teens in a newly blended family drew additional outrage on X, with some users calling the depiction inappropriate.
  • Despite the fallout, ratings were strong: about 5.07 million viewers overall (18.7% share) and roughly 770,000 in the 14–49 demo (13.2%), trailing Tatort in total audience as ZDF said the series seeks a positive takeaway.
